activemq-users m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From muralimohan <muralih...@gmail.com>
Subject ERROR: Detected missing journal files - When upgrading from 5.9 to 5.15.3
Date Thu, 15 Mar 2018 14:27:45 GMT
A part of the stack trace is given below. As the subject says, I am upgrading
from ActiveMQ 5.9 to 5.15.3.  I do see someone raised a similar issue for
5.14 upgrade, but there were no good solutions apart from removing the
journals (I guess the db*.log files are what are being referred to as
journals). I do not want to delete those logs, which will mean I delete the
persistent messages in the Queue?

How can I proceed?

Stacktrace:

2018-03-14 13:56:39,716 | WARN  | Some journal files are missing: [59183] |
org.apache.activemq.store.kahadb.MessageDatabase | main
2018-03-14 13:56:39,718 | ERROR | Detected missing journal files. [59183] |
org.apache.activemq.store.kahadb.MessageDatabase | main
2018-03-14 13:56:39,719 | ERROR | Failed to start Apache ActiveMQ
(vlmql001.test.camelot, null) | org.apache.activemq.broker.BrokerService |
main
java.io.IOException: Detected missing journal files. [59183]
        at
org.apache.activemq.store.kahadb.MessageDatabase.recoverIndex(MessageDatabase.java:979)
        at
org.apache.activemq.store.kahadb.MessageDatabase$5.execute(MessageDatabase.java:717)
        at
org.apache.activemq.store.kahadb.disk.page.Transaction.execute(Transaction.java:779)
        at
org.apache.activemq.store.kahadb.MessageDatabase.recover(MessageDatabase.java:714)
        at
org.apache.activemq.store.kahadb.MessageDatabase.open(MessageDatabase.java:473)
        at
org.apache.activemq.store.kahadb.MessageDatabase.load(MessageDatabase.java:493)
        at
org.apache.activemq.store.kahadb.MessageDatabase.doStart(MessageDatabase.java:297)
        at
org.apache.activemq.store.kahadb.KahaDBStore.doStart(KahaDBStore.java:219)
        at
org.apache.activemq.util.ServiceSupport.start(ServiceSupport.java:55)
        at
org.apache.activemq.store.kahadb.KahaDBPersistenceAdapter.doStart(KahaDBPersistenceAdapter.java:232)
        at
org.apache.activemq.util.ServiceSupport.start(ServiceSupport.java:55)
        at
org.apache.activemq.broker.BrokerService.doStartPersistenceAdapter(BrokerService.java:687)
        at
org.apache.activemq.broker.BrokerService.startPersistenceAdapter(BrokerService.java:671)
        at
org.apache.activemq.broker.BrokerService.start(BrokerService.java:635)
        at
org.apache.activemq.xbean.XBeanBrokerService.afterPropertiesSet(XBeanBrokerService.java:73)
        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
        at
s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
        at
s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
        at java.lang.reflect.Method.invoke(Method.java:498)
        at
org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.invokeCustomInitMethod(AbstractAutowireCapableBeanFactory.java:1758)
        at
org.springframework.beans.factory.support.AbstractAutowireCapableBean



--
Sent from: http://activemq.2283324.n4.nabble.com/ActiveMQ-User-f2341805.html

Mime
View raw message